Transaction 0714648adb214b19f28fb6f79b81c90cb22d13cb2993ed3470ce7f57455158e8

2 Input
2 Outputs
  • 0714648adb214b19f28fb6f79b81c90cb22d13cb2993ed3470ce7f57455158e8:0
  • value  492500000
    address  1DApzcw6uq7VmhZWMof8VHypFcMrW2Qj9T
  • 0714648adb214b19f28fb6f79b81c90cb22d13cb2993ed3470ce7f57455158e8:1
  • value  26155
    address  1JfskCNwtrv8cRuY46YfqmaPkz6hpga4UK